What is a 40 Ft Container?
A 40-foot shipping container is a standardized modular system used for carrying items across international waters, rail, and road. These containers are available in two main types: standard dry containers and high cube containers.
Requirement Dry Container: Typically has interior dimensions of roughly 39.5 ft in length, 7.9 ft in width, and 7.9 ft in height.High Cube Container: Similar in length and width however has an extra foot in height, making it 8.5 ft high, supplying additional storage capacity.Key Specifications of a 40 Ft ContainerSpecStandard Dry ContainerHigh Cube ContainerExternal Dimensions (ft)40 x 8 x 8.540 x 8 x 9.5Internal Length (ft)39.539.5Internal Width (ft)7.77.7Internal Height (ft)7.98.5Maximum Gross Weight (pounds)67,20067,200Payload Capacity (pounds)Approximately 58,900Roughly 58,900Expense Breakdown of a 40 Ft Container

What is the standard life expectancy of a shipping container?
Usually, a properly maintained shipping container can last anywhere from 10 to 25 years, depending upon factors like environmental conditions and usage.
2. Can I customize a shipping container?
Absolutely! Numerous individuals customize containers for numerous uses, consisting of homes, workplaces, or storage units. Be sure to examine regional guidelines regarding modifications.
3. Is it better to lease or buy a shipping container?
This depends on your particular needs. Leasing is ideal for short-term requirements, while buying is more cost-effective for long-term use.
4. Do I need a license to put a shipping container on my home?
This differs by location. Many towns need permits, particularly if the container is to be used completely or modified.
5. How do I carry a shipping container?
Transporting a shipping container generally requires using a flatbed truck or specialized container transportation vehicles. It's advised to employ experts knowledgeable about these logistics.
